**Runbook: Cold starts on the Pindrop handlers**

Heads up, RM: the Pindrop serverless handlers take 6–9s on first invocation after a deploy, so expect a latency blip right after rollout. Pre-warm by hitting the health route a dozen times per region before flipping traffic. If warm latency stays high, roll back. Note the deployed build below for the record.

pipeline stamp: htk4_ae36

The cleanup job that purges soft-deleted rows from the Marrowfield orders table has been failing since Monday. Rows with deleted_at set older than 90 days should be hard-removed nightly, but the job needs credentials from the Stonegate vault, which auto-locked after three failed auth attempts. Until it is reopened, soft-deleted orders will accumulate and the table will keep growing. As the contractor picking this up, you can unlock the vault with the recovery passphrase below.

vault phrase of taweg-kafof = oliax-zorael

### Step 2: Update DocSweep's rule profile

Alright, this is the step that usually trips people up. DocSweep 3.0 replaces the old per-repo lint profiles with a single org-wide profile, so before you cut the release you need to collapse the existing rule sets into one. The merger script in tools/ handles most of it, but it won't pick sensible severities for the deprecated heading rules — those default to "error" and will block every docs build at Quillmore. To avoid that, apply the profile configuration below.

service settings:
[silwyn]
host = silwyn.crelvogrid.internal
user = silwyn_svc
database = silwyn_prod